[This notebook](https://observablehq.com/@lsh/bqn) shows how to run it in an Observable notebook. + +#### CBQN + +C sources are kept in the [CBQN](https://github.com/dzaima/CBQN) repository, but they also require the self-hosted bytecode to be built using cc.bqn in that repository. Although cc.bqn is typically run with dzaima/BQN, this can be changed by modifying the `#!` line at the beginning, or linking `dbqn` to a different executable. To use only the BQN and CBQN repositories, avoiding dzaima/BQN, first build with bqn.js—this is slow, but should take under a minute even on low-end hardware—then switch to CBQN itself afterwards for faster builds. + ### dzaima/BQN [dzaima/BQN](https://github.com/dzaima/BQN/) is an implementation in Java created by modifying the existing dzaima/APL.
